Glenn Morris <rgm <at> gnu.org> writes:
> Andrea Corallo wrote:
>
>> Okay af739863b0 when running the testsuite is adding in front of
>> `comp-eln-load-path' a temporary directory such that now all native
>> compilations tests are deposed and loaded there. Does is look like a
>> good solution?
>
> Hard-coding a check in startup.el based on a setting for HOME that
> happens to be used by the test-suite doesn't look like a good solution
> to me. I'm not familiar with the native compilation branch, so I won't
> try to suggest an alternative. Also, the Emacs tests generally try to
> clean up when they exit, and it looks like nothing ever deletes this
> temporary directory?
Hi Glenn,
if we have a better idea on how to detect we are running the testsuite
we can use that in place. Maybe defining a dedicated env variable
during the build?
